Responsibilities
- Provide intensive care to patients recovering from cardiovascular surgeries, including open-heart and valve replacement procedures
- Monitor and manage hemodynamic status, ventilators, and advanced cardiac devices such as ECMO, IABP, and LVAD
- Administer critical medications, IV drips, and titrate vasoactive drugs as needed
- Collaborate with cardiologists, surgeons, and multidisciplinary teams to develop and implement patient care plans
- Assess and respond to changes in patient conditions with rapid, precise interventions
- Educate patients and families on post-operative care and disease management
- Maintain accurate and detailed patient records in compliance with hospital policies
- Adhere to strict infection control and patient safety protocols
Qualifications
- Active Registered Nurse (RN) license in applicable state(s)
- Minimum 2 years of CVICU or ICU experience
-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) and Basic Life Support (BLS) certifications required
- Critical Care Registered Nurse (CCRN) certification preferred
- Proficiency in managing ventilators, arterial lines, central lines, and cardiac monitoring equipment
- Strong critical thinking and decision-making skills in high-pressure situations
- Experience with electronic medical records (EMR) systems preferred
